Iran national under-23 football team, also known as Iran U-23 or Iran Olympic Team; represents Iran in international football competitions in Olympic Games, Asian Games and AFC U-22 Asian Cup, as well as any other under-23 international football tournaments. It is controlled by the Iran Football Federation.
History
    
The winner of the gold medal at the 2002 Asian Games, the team was prepared to defend its championship title at the football tournament of the 2006 Asian Games in Doha, Qatar. Despite a suspension by FIFA, preventing Iran to enter any international football competition,[2] the Iran under-23 team was given special permission to participate in the Asian Games,[3] where they won the bronze medal.
Wild cards
    
Football at the Asian Games has required that under-23 players enter the competitions, but they have allowed three over-age players can be included in the squad. Iran used three players, known as the "Wild cards", in three versions of the games in 2002, 2006 and 2010:
| Competition | Wild card 1 | Wild card 2 | Wild card 3 | 
|---|---|---|---|
| 2002 Asian Games | Ali Daei (C) | Yahya Golmohammadi | Ebrahim Mirzapour (GK) | 
| 2006 Asian Games | Hassan Roudbarian (C/GK) | Arash Borhani | Jalal Hosseini | 
| 2010 Asian Games | Mehdi Rahmati (C/GK) | Gholamreza Rezaei |
